MNIT Jaipur has achieved various rankings that are mentioned in the table given below:

Ranking Body

Category

Ranks

QS University Ranking 2026

QS Sustainability Ranking

1501+

Times Higher Education Ranking 2026

 

Overall

601

NIRF 2025

Engineering

42

NIRF 2025

Architecture

12

NIRF 2025

Overall

77

India Today Ranking 2025

 

Engineering (Government)

15

Yes, MNIT Jaipur has a good campus and gives many facilities  to the students. The college has a huge campus spread over 317 acres. Malaviya National Institute of Technology also has various infrastructure facilities like library, canteens, guest houses etc.

No, MNIT Jaipur is not affiliated with any university. MNIT Jaipur is an independent institute which was established in 1963. The college gives many courses to students. This courses include various UG, PG, as well as Doctorate courses.

The MAT cutoff for MNIT Jaipur MBA and MNNIT Allahabad MBA is generally around 80 percentile or above. The exact cutoff may change each year. Students can check the official site of the institutes to know more. Graduation with 60% or above is also required.
